This is my 1983 Audi GT Coupe. 1983 was a year of transition for Audi and there was very few 83 GT Coupes put into production. My dad purchased this car brand new in Germany while he was stationed there. This car has seen everything from the Autobahn to Interstate 40. The car started to have major engine problems in the year 2000 and my dad decided to park her. When I turned 16 I told my dad that I wanted the car and we began a quest to rebuild her from top to bottom. The proces was lengthy and we ran into many problems but it is now completed and in perfect condition.
